JT climbing El Cap



Finally, I am back in the Yosemite Valley to finish the mission that I set out for this May. I will be climbing "the Nose", El Cap's most classic popular route. I will be following my Bulgarian friend Ivo Ninov, he knows what he is doing. So do my friends Bjarte Bo and Eiliv Ruud. They are visiting from Norway with Tom Erik Heimen who, like me is a rookie. This makes our team a team of 5. Looking forward to some vertical camping with good friends.

Yesterday, we fixed the first mini pitch and hauled one haul bag of gear up there. Today we will continue that process, so that once we get a good weather window, we can charge up the mountains with the first 4 pitches fixed (ropes set up for us to easily ascend). It takes some time to organize all the gear and food and everything for these climbing operations. Fascinating stuff.
